Definitions ofcontours

1noun
  • An outline, boundary or border, usually of curved shape.

    Example: "the low drag contour of a modern automobile"

  • A line on a map or chart delineating those points which have the same altitude or other plotted quantity: a contour line or isopleth.

    Synonyms: "contour line"

  • A speech sound which behaves as a single segment, but which makes an internal transition from one quality, place, or manner to another.
